/*=== Setup ===*/
*{
	border: 0;
	margin: 0;
	padding: 0
}
/* ===Body === */
body{
	background: url(../images/bgr.gif) #f5f3f3 repeat-y center;
	color: #333333;
	font: .7em Arial,Helvetica,Sans-Serif
}
/* === a === */
a{
	color: #a2b71b;
	text-decoration: none
}
/* === a hover === */
a:hover{
	text-decoration: underline
}
/* ==== input === */
input,select,textarea{
	border: #afafaf 1px solid;
	font-size: 11px;
	padding: 2px
}
/* ==== li === */
li{
	list-style: none
}
/* === h2 === */
h2{
	color: #696868;
	font-size: 21px;
	font-weight: normal;
	letter-spacing: -1px
}
/* === h3 === */
h3{
	font-size: 1.8em;
	font-weight: normal;
	margin: 0 0 1em
}
/* === h3-em === */
h3 em{
	color: #990000;
	font-style: normal
}
/* === h4 === */
h4{
	font-size: 1.5em;
	font-weight: normal;
	margin: 0 0 .5em
}
/* ==== h5 === */
h5{
	font-size: 1.2em;
	font-weight: normal;
	margin: 0 0 .3em
}
/* === P === */
p{
	line-height: 1.5em;
	padding: 0 0 1.5em
}
/*=== Layout ===*/
#page{
	margin: 0 auto;
	width: 1000px
}
/*=== Header ===*/
#header{
	background: url(../images/head-bg.jpg) no-repeat;
	height: 120px
	
}
/* === Header - Spacer === */
#header .spacer{
	color: #ffffff;
	float: right;
	padding: 7px 15px 0 0;
	text-align: right
}
/* ===  header- Spacer - a === */
#header .spacer a{
	color: #ffffff
}
/* === header spacer a:hover === */
#header .spacer a:hover{
	color: #b8d210
}
/* === header-spacer-li === */
#header .spacer li{
	display: inline;
	padding: 0 0 0 15px
}
/* === date === */
.date{
	padding: 0px 0 0
}
/*- Logo -*/
#header h1{
	background: url(../images/logo.gif) no-repeat;
	float: left;
	text-indent: -9999px;
	width: 196px
}
/* === header h1 a === */
#header h1 a{
	display: block;
	height: 120px
}
/* === header h1 a:hover === */
#header h1 a:hover{
	text-decoration: none
}
/*=== Navigation ===*/
/*- Nav1 -*/
#nav1{
	background: #a2b71b;
	color: #ffffff;
	font-size: 12px;
	height: 42px
}
/* === nav1 u1 === */
#nav1 ul{
	float: left
}
/* === nav1 li === */
#nav1 li{
	border-right: 1px solid #bccb5a;
	float: left;
	line-height: 42px
}
/* === nave li a === */
#nav1 li a{
	color: #ffffff;
	display: block;
	float: left;
	padding: 0 10px
}
#nav1 li a:hover,
#nav1 li.active a{
	background: #93a619;
	text-decoration: none
}
/*- Nav2 -*/
.nav2{
	font-size: 11px;
	margin: 0 0 1em
}
.nav2 li{
	border-bottom: 1px solid #e3e1e1
}
.nav2 li a{
	background: url(../images/nav2-ico.gif) no-repeat 2px 9px;
	color: #333333;
	display: block;
	height: 23px;
	line-height: 23px;
	padding: 0 0 0 15px
}
.nav2 li a:hover,
.nav2 li.active a{
	background: url(../images/nav2-ico.gif) #f0f0f0 no-repeat 2px 9px;
	color: #eb127d;
	text-decoration: none
}
/*- Nav3 -*/
.nav3{
	float: left;
	padding: 0 30px 0 10px
}
.nav3 h4{
	margin: 0 0 1.5em
}
.nav3 ul{
	border-right: 1px solid #a3a5a8;
	padding: 0 50px 0 0;
}
.nav3 li{
	margin: 0 0 .8em
}
.nav3 li a{
	color: #17bed7
}
/*- Navigation Path -*/
.path{
	color: #2e2e2f;
	height: 1%;
	padding: 0 0 1em
}
.path a{
	color: #2e2e2f;
	padding: 0 2px;
	text-decoration: underline
}
.path strong{
	color: #eb127d;
	font-weight: normal
}
/*=== All Columns ===*/
#columns{
	height: 1%;
	margin: 13px 0 0;
	padding: 0 13px 15px
}
/*=== Sub Columns ===*/
.col1{
	float: left;
	width: 725px
}
.col2{
	float: right;
	width: 236px
}
.col3{
	float: right;
	width: 478px
}
.col3-myaccount{
	float: left;
	width: 720px
}
.col4{
	background: url(../images/col4-bgr.gif) #97999c repeat-x top;
	height: 1%;
	padding: 15px 18px
}
.col4 h2{
	color: #ffffff;
	margin: 0 0 .5em 10px
}
.col5{
	float: left;
	width: 273px
}
.col6{
	float: right;
	width: 440px
}
/*=== Styling Boxes ===*/
/*- Box1 -*/
.box{
	margin: 0 0 13px	
}
.box1{
	margin: 0 0 13px;
	height: 0px;
	
}
.box .top{
	background: url(../images/box-top.gif) no-repeat left top;
	clear: both;
	height: 48px;
	overflow: hidden
}
.box .top-{
	background: url(../images/box-top-.gif) no-repeat right top;
	height: 48px;
	overflow: hidden
}

.box .top h2{
	float: left;
	line-height: 48px;
	padding: 0 15px
}
.box .bot{
	background: url(../images/box-bot.gif) repeat-x top;
	clear: both;
	color: #ffffff;
	font-size: 11px;
	height: 32px;
	line-height: 32px;
	overflow: hidden;
	padding: 0 15px
}
.box .bot a{
	color: #ffffff
}
.box .spacer, .box .spacer2{
	background: #ffffff;
	height: 1%;
	padding: 15px 1px 5px
}
.box .spacer2{
	padding: 16px 3px 20px
}
/*- Box2 -*/
.box2{
	margin: 0 0 1em;
	width: 938px
}
.box2 .top,.box2 .bot{
	background: url(../images/box2-top.gif) no-repeat top;
	clear: both;
	height: 10px;
	overflow: hidden
}
.box2 .bot{
	background: url(../images/box2-bot.gif) no-repeat top
}
.box2 .spacer{
	background: url(../images/box2-bgr.gif) #eae9ea repeat-x top;
	display: table-cell;
	display: block;
	height: 1%;
	height: auto !important;
	height: 210px;
	min-height: 210px;
	padding: 10px 15px 0
}
/*=== Wrappers ===*/
/*- Wrap1 -*/
.wrap1{
	background: url(../images/grad1.gif) repeat-x bottom;
	float: left;
	font-size: 11px;
	height: 100px;
	margin: 0 2px;
	text-align: center;
	width: 84px

}
.wrap1 h5{
	background: #e0e0e0;
	font-size: 12px;
	font-weight: normal;
	height: 21px;
	line-height: 21px
}
.wrap1 h6{
	font-size: 11px
}
.wrap1 img{
	margin: 7px 0
}
/*=== Styling Lists ===*/
/*- List1 -*/
.list1{
	margin: 0 0 1em;
	padding-left: 10px;
}
.list1 li{
	background: url(../images/ico-list.gif) no-repeat 0 3px;
	border-bottom: 1px solid #e3e1e1;
	margin: 0 0 1.2em;
	padding: 0 0 1.2em 15px
	
}
.list1 li.last{
	border: 0
}
/*- List2 -*/
.list2{
	margin: 0 0 1.5em;
	padding: 0 0 0 15px
}
.list2 li{
	background: url(../images/ico-list2.gif) no-repeat 0 4px;
	margin: 0 0 .3em;
	padding: 0 0 0 13px
}
/*=== Styling Forms ===*/
input.btn{
	background: none;
	border: 0;
	margin: 0;
	padding: 0
}


select{
	padding: 1px
}
/*- Search -*/
#search{
	float: right;
	height: 19px;
	margin: 11px 10px 0 0;
	width: 255px
}
#search label{
	float: left;
	margin: 3px 5px 0 0
}
#search input{
	background: #eeeeee;
	float: left;
	width: 143px
}
#search .btn{
	background: none;
	margin: 0 0 0 10px;
	width: auto
}
/*- Form1 Setup -*/
.form1{
	text-align: right
}
.form1 a{
	color: #333333
}
.form1 a:hover{
	color: #eb127d;
	text-decoration: none
}
.form1 div{
	margin: 0 0 7px
}
.form1 label{
	float: left;
	font-size: 11px;
	margin: 3px 0 0;
	width: 60px
}
.form1 input{
	width: 135px
}
.form1 .btn{
	margin: 5px 0 0;
	width: auto
}
/*=== Pics, Ads etc. ===*/
.pic img{
	display: block
}
.ad-725 img{
	display: block;
	margin: 0 0 1em
}
/*=== Footer ===*/
#footer{
	background: #313131;
	color: #ffffff;
	height: 1%;
	padding: 10px 15px
}
#footer a{
	color: #ffffff
}
#footer ul{
	text-align: right
}
#footer li{
	display: inline;
	padding: 0 0 0 15px
}
/*=== Misc. ===*/
.fix{
	clear: both;
	height: 1px;
	margin: -1px 0 0;
	overflow: hidden
}
.fl{
	float: left
}
.fr{
	float: right
}
.ac{
	text-align: center
}
.ar{
	text-align: right
}
.formmaindiv
{
   text-align:center;
   width:480px;
   
}

.newspadding
{
padding-left:12px;
padding-right:12px;
}

.addpagespadding
{

padding-right:12px;
}
.wspadding
{
padding-left:12px;
padding-right:12px;
}
.logindiv
{
padding-right:12px;
}

/*******************Business Page Styles Starts Here*****************/
.content_emptyspacer
{
	width:10px;
	float:left;
}

.content_emptyspacer2
{
	width:12px;
	float:left;
}
/*******************Business Page Styles Ends Here*****************/
